The Baths and Their Benefits

The beer bath is perhaps the most talked-about feature. It’s not just a novelty—warm water infused with brewer’s yeast and hop extracts aims to hydrate the skin, reduce inflammation, and boost skin regeneration. Many reviews highlight how relaxing and skin-softening the beer soak feels, with comments like “my fatigue disappeared after just a few minutes.”

The wine bath offers a luxurious alternative, made from red wine, grape seed and vine extracts, honey, and fragrant oils. The antioxidants and nutrients are said to revitalize the body and improve circulation. Notably, you get two glasses of Prosecco included—so you can sip while soaking, which adds a touch of indulgence.

The wellness treatments go beyond baths, with options like carbonic, mud, magnesium, and oxygen baths—each designed for specific health benefits, from detoxification to muscle relaxation.

Is the spa suitable for children?
Children from age 5 and above can accompany you, but children under 18 are not allowed in the treatments.

Can I bring my own swimsuit?
You don’t need to bring one, as towels and sheets are provided, but if you prefer to wear one, you’re welcome to.

How long does the experience last?
The treatment lasts about an hour, making it a quick but memorable break during your day in Prague.

Is the location easy to find?
Yes, it’s only 2 minutes walk from the I.P. Pavlov stop in central Prague, easily reachable from most parts of the city.

What amenities are included?
You’ll receive a private changing room with lockers, a towel, slippers, and a sheet. Drinks are unlimited, and snacks are available.

Can I cancel my booking?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ours before your appointment for a full refund. Reservation and payment are flexible, allowing you to keep plans open.

Are there any restrictions?
Smoking is not allowed, and the experience is not suitable for wheelchair users.

What languages are available?
Guidance is available in Czech, English, and Russian, ensuring clear communication.
